All my games were published first by me in some form (email, websites, itch.io, etc). Cronosoft is a way of getting physical cassettes out there. Re: Any way to do this in Pasmo?
Sorry, but I can’t get this to work as you like. I think the problem is that ## only works within MACRO statements, as I use it, but IRP & REPT both effectively use a local DEFL to hold the iteration/parameter, which you can’t then pass to macros.
